A vapor permeable weather barrier is an advanced building material designed to protect structures from external moisture while allowing internal water vapor to escape. This innovative membrane serves as a critical component in modern construction, creating a breathable envelope that maintains building integrity and indoor air quality. The vapor permeable weather barrier functions as a protective shield against wind-driven rain, snow, and outdoor humidity, preventing water infiltration that could damage insulation, framing, and interior finishes. Its sophisticated technology enables the passage of water vapor molecules from inside to outside, preventing condensation buildup within wall cavities that leads to mold growth, wood rot, and structural deterioration. The barrier typically consists of a synthetic material with microscopic pores engineered to block liquid water while permitting vapor transmission. This dual-action capability makes the vapor permeable weather barrier essential for energy-efficient construction and renovation projects. Applications span residential homes, commercial buildings, and institutional facilities where moisture management is paramount. The material installs directly over exterior sheathing before siding or cladding installation, forming a secondary drainage plane that channels any penetrating moisture downward and outward. Modern formulations offer enhanced durability, UV resistance, and tear strength, ensuring long-term performance across diverse climatic conditions.
